Summary:
We are seeking a skilled delivery-focused Projector Program Manager to lead ADAS engineering initiatives across multiple vehicle platforms. This role involves managing end-to-end delivery of ADAS features, driving innovation in sensor fusion and perception systems, and collaborating with OEMs, Tier-1 suppliers, and internal teams. The ideal candidate will have 8 to 14 years of experience in embedded systems, real-time software, and automotive safety standards, with hands-on exposure to NVIDIA DRIVE platforms and Gen-AI engineering accelerators.

Roles & Responsibilities:
1. Support Software development for ADAS Projects
2.Program Leadership: Manage planning, execution, and delivery of ADAS programs across vehicle platforms.
2. System Engineering: Define system requirements and architecture for ADAS features such as lane keeping assistance, adaptive cruise control, and collision avoidance.
3. Sensor Fusion & Perception: Oversee development of algorithms using radar, LiDAR, and camera systems, leveragingADAS SOC framework.
4. Validation & Testing: Lead simulation and real-world testing using for synthetic data generation and scenario validation.
5. Compliance & Safety: Ensure adherence to ISO 26262, ASPICE, and cybersecurity standards.
6. Stakeholder Collaboration: Align with OEMs, Tier-1 suppliers, and internal teams on technical and programming goals.
7. Cloud & V2X Integration: Support development of cloud-based vehicle data platforms and V2X communication strategies.
8. Model-Based Development: Promote use of AUTOSAR and model-based design tools for scalable ADAS solutions.
9. AI/ML Enablement: Integrate AI/ML for perception and decision-making, including GenAI for code generation, test automation, and documentation.
10. GenAI Accelerators: Utilize GenAI tools for requirements analysis, defect prediction, test case generation, and engineering knowledge reuse.
11. Client Engagements: Represent the organization in customer discussions and technical workshops.
12. Vendor Coordination: Manage vendor relationships to ensure timely and quality delivery.
13. Onsite-Offshore Coordination: Lead distributed teams across geographies for seamless collaboration.
14. Quality Assurance: Implement validation frameworks using NVIDIA Isaac Sim and GenAI-powered analytics.
15. Team Development: Mentor engineers and domain experts in ADAS systems.
16. Solutioning: Drive end-to-end solutioning for ADAS systems, integrating technical feasibility with business value
